Every time a security incident occurs on the network a CEZAR form is filled in.
CEZAR is SNCF’s security incidents database.
CEZAR means:ConnaissancE des Zones A Risques (knowledge of zones at risk).

Information on the CEZAR form is entered into the dedicated CEZAR database.
The following typology is used for metal theft:◦ Main category : THEFT◦ Type : SIMPLE THEFT or THEFT WITH INTRUSION◦ Main Consequence : SNCF◦ Second Consequence : METAL or TRACK MATERIAL , ATTEMPTED
THEFT
Other details can be entered :◦ Offenders involved◦ Offenders arrested◦ Victim categories◦ Number of trains affected◦ Total time lost◦ Type of metal and weight◦ Estimated cost

Geo-profiling is an investigative methodology that uses the locations of a connected series of crimes to determine the most probable area of offender residence (or base, or anchor point).
Originally developed to help police locate serial killers, rapists and arsonists, geographic profiling can be applied to any circumstances where an unidentified person is known to have carried out criminal activities at a series of known geographic points.
Very useful to explore high volume crime series such as metal theft on the railway network.

An investigator from the Gendarmerie Nationale (Cooperation Unit) came to us to make a geo-profile of a series of thefts committed on the network.
A series of thefts was detected in the east of France and investigators already had some clues.
They had already done the linkage process and attributed all the offences in the series to the same group of suspected offenders.

The thefts were entered in the CEZAR database.
We extracted the entries from the database and made a simple map of their position in ArcGIS.
In this way we could assign geographical coordinates to each of the thefts.
Then the crime sites and clue locations were entered into RIGEL®.

Investigators suspected an organized crime group operating in the area. This group used the same modus operandi for each crime. In an abandoned vehicle used by the group, investigators found a piece of metal from the SNCF, this clue allowed them to make the connection between the group and this series of crimes.

Investigators made a search of premises used by the group and found more SNCF material.
The premises were found to be within a zone identified by RIGEL.
